A Virtual Private Network (VPN) is a technology that creates an encrypted connection between computers over a public network. This has obvious advantages when used as a proxy, as is often referred to as a VPN tunnel.

Once set up, a VPN is just like your normal internet connection, although with the benefit (depending on provider) of being able to select which IP and country you’d like to appear as to the internet. Though hassle free and highly anonymized, a lot of people get a VPN just to circumvent country filters, for instance to watch TV shows normally reserved for Americans only.
